CTRL CV Mapping
CTRL CV Input:
The
CTRL CV Input
can be mapped to one of three
parameters. This mapping can function independent of the
Fader
parameter mapping.
1.
Mix Profile Scan:
Press and hold the
Mix Profile Button
and then
press the
CTRL Button
to map the
CTRL CV Input
to the
Mix Profile
Scan
parameter. (The
CTRL CV Input
is mapped to the
Mix Profile
Scan
parameter by default)
2. I
ntervallic Offset:
With the
CTRL Button
illuminated white and the
Intervallic Offset
parameter active to the
Fader
, press and hold the
CTRL Button
and then press the
Sub Button
to map the
CTRL CV
Input
to the
Intervallic Offset
parameter.
3.
Global Detune:
With the
CTRL Button
illuminated amber and the
Global Detune
parameter active to the
Fader
, press and hold the
CTRL Button
and then press the
Sub Button
to map the
CTRL Input
to
the
Global Detune
parameter.
Note:
When pressing and holding the
CTRL Button
before pressing the
Sub Button
to define
CTRL CV Input
mapping, the
CTRL Button
LED
will flip colour as if it switched between
Intervallic Offset
and
Global
Detune
. When the
Sub Button
is pressed this will flip back as the
button press was intended for
CTRL CV Input
mapping and not a
parameter change.
CTRL CV Attenuverter:
The
CTRL CV Attenuverter
will scale and/or
invert the control voltage signal present at the
CTRL CV Input
.
•
Control voltage is scaled and/or inverted by the
CTRL CV
Attenuverter
and summed with the parameter’s
Fader
position.
